Rep. Ro Khanna Detained by Israeli Settlers and IDF

Incident sparks diplomatic conflict and calls for firing.

Event Overview

Rep. Ro Khanna reported being detained by armed Israeli settlers and the IDF while visiting a demolished Palestinian village in the West Bank. The IDF claims they intervened to disperse civilians and reopen the road, while Israel Police stated the group entered a closed military zone. Tucker Carlson subsequently called for the removal of U.S. Ambassador Mike Huckabee, citing Huckabee's silence on the matter.

Three outlets offered distinct perspectives on the incident: one framed it as evidence of the human toll of occupation, one presented a conflict of narratives between the congressman and the IDF, and one highlighted internal right-wing disputes over government failure.
